  • Subframe is a strong choice for teams that want to design and ship polished React UIs quickly, offering a visual builder that outputs clean, production-ready code and integrates well with existing developer workflows.

Why this product is good

  • Visual editor that generates clean, production-ready React and Tailwind CSS code
  • Comes with a library of pre-built, customizable components to speed up development
  • Bridges the gap between design and code, reducing handoff friction between designers and developers
  • Lets developers ship polished UIs quickly without starting from scratch
  • Integrates into existing codebases and workflows rather than locking you into a proprietary system

Recommended for

  • Startups and small teams that need to build and iterate on UIs fast
  • Developers who want to accelerate frontend work with React and Tailwind
  • Product teams looking to streamline the design-to-code handoff
  • SaaS companies building polished, modern web application interfaces
